Analysis Notes
Place of Performance Largest percentage of work under issued task orders completed at: Buzzards Bay, Massachusetts 2532 United States.
Multiple Award Schedule The Ordering Period End Date of Mulitple Award Schedules can be extended via three 5 year options for up to 20 years. If all options are exercised, this Schedule will end in January 2034.
Ceiling Exceeded Total obligated funds of $13,100,981 has exceeded the reported contract ceiling of $1,163,784. This may prevent future funds from being obligated to this federal supply schedule. Note, however, that the government can often amend the ceiling to allow for additional awards or in some cases may not have properly updated the ceiling in public records.
Amendment Since initial award the Ordering Period End Date was extended from 01/26/19 to 01/26/29.
Veterans Elite was awarded Multiple Award Schedule (MAS) GS21F043BA GS21F043BA by the General Services Administration (GSA) for Federal Supply Schedule Contract in January 2014. The schedule has a current duration of 15 years (up to 20 years if all options exercised) and was awarded full & open with NAICS 238220 and PSC J035 via direct negotiation acquisition procedures with 999 bids received. To date, $13,265,155 has been obligated through this vehicle with a potential value of all existing task orders of $14,176,743. The total ceiling is $1,163,784, of which 101% has been used. As of today, the FSS has a total reported backlog of $1,075,763 and funded backlog of $164,175.
